Wire brush all bolt threads, carefully inspect each one, and replace any that are nicked, deformed or worn. If a bolt doesn’t …May 6, 2020 · 10. Tighten the cylinder head bolts. 10.1. Tighten the M11 cylinder head bolts a first pass in sequence to 30 N.m (22 lb ft). 10.2. Tighten the M11 cylinder head bolts a second pass in sequence to 90 degrees. 10.3. Tighten the M11 cylinder head bolts (1-8) to 90 degrees and the M11 cylinder head bolts (9 and 10) to 50 degrees a final pass in ... 333. black. 02 ss camaro. 15 mm bolts first pass torque of 22 ft/lbs. 2nd pass of 90 degrees on the 15 mm bolts. 3rd pass of 90 on the 15's except fot the 2 on the outside of the head under the valve cover...only 50 degrees on the 3rd pass for those 2 bolts. Tighten bolts 11 through 15 to 31 Nm (23 lb ...In some cases the stretching approaches the bolts’ elastic limit, permanently stretching them. Reusing stretched T-T-Y head bolts can cause improper or uneven torque, damaged engine threads, and broken bolts, any of which could lead to head gasket failure. Step 4 : M11 bolts 9&10 a further 50 degree turn. Sometimes i feel like my life is going nowhere....But then i start my V8.No, it is not close, it is the same. The torque/angle method is just that-a method of tightening the bolt. TTY (torque-to-yield) is the type of bolt (meant to be used with the torque/angle method of tightening). Cylinder Head Bolts (Final Pass all M11 Bolts in Sequence-Excluding the Medium Length Bolts at the Front and Rear of Each Cylinder Head) 90 degrees.Jan 27, 2006 · Tighten the M11 cylinder head bolts (1-8) to 90 degrees and the M11 cylinder head bolts (9 and 10) to 50 degrees a final pass in sequence using J 36660-A . Tighten the M8 cylinder head bolts (11-15) to 30 N·m (22 lb ft). Begin with the center bolt (11) and alternating side-to-side, work outward tightening all of the bolts. The search feature is available on the Specifications Looku...In some cases the stretching approaches the bolts’ elastic limit, permanently stretching them. Reusing stretched T-T-Y head bolts can cause improper or uneven torque, damaged engine threads, and broken bolts, any of which could lead to head gasket failure.
